Omma avus
Taxonomy
Omma avus was named by Ponomarenko (1969). Its type specimen is PIN 371/972, an exoskeleton, and it is an impression. Its type locality is Ak-Bulak-Say, Sogjuta, Issyk-Kul (PIN Collection 371), which is in a Hettangian/Sinemurian lacustrine - small siliciclastic in the Dzhil Formation of Kyrgyzstan.
